Output 61bcd78c684ec0fe5e18e23e612dbd298c3d0d7766c3944d03a583fb14a4ea44:0

value
595919490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 201fade02b5f36470718744184ce340d5594c123 OP_EQUAL
address
34csVnt4PKfpetRhmanShbnH9t29WuKGjq
transaction
61bcd78c684ec0fe5e18e23e612dbd298c3d0d7766c3944d03a583fb14a4ea44
confirmations
518466
spent
true